Thema: NFO Problem
Einzelnen Beitrag anzeigen
Alt 03.04.2011, 14:54   #26
Stifler
König
Punkte: 39.887, Level: 100 Punkte: 39.887, Level: 100 Punkte: 39.887, Level: 100
Levelaufstieg: 0% Levelaufstieg: 0% Levelaufstieg: 0%
Aktivität: 0% Aktivität: 0% Aktivität: 0%
Letzte Erfolge
Auszeichnungen
 
Benutzerbild von Stifler
 
Registriert seit: 14.02.2011
Ort: Graz
Alter: 40
Beitr?ge: 1.495
Abgegebene Danke: 82
Erhielt 200 Danke für 37 Beiträge
Downloads: 11
Uploads: 0
Nachrichten: 6230
Renommee-Modifikator:
3169 Stif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es AnsehenStifler genießt hohes Ansehen
Standard

PHP-Code:
if(in_array('html',array('htm','html','shtm','shtml'))) 
und

PHP-Code:
if(preg_match('/^.*htm.*$/','html')) 
for Schleife mit $i<=6000

Fazit in_array ist ca. 40% schneller!

preg_match() = 0.1394340000
in_array() = 0.1061300000

Würde dir mal Gut tun nicht immer aus Jux und Tollerei den Obergscheiten raushängen zu lassen und hin und wider mal zur Kenntnis nehmen dass ein anderer auch Recht hat!
Das macht zwar Eindruck bei den Anfängern ist aber extremst ärgerlich bei Leuten die sich auch auskennen!

Das RegEx ne langsame Gurcke sollte jeder wissen und mit Arrays zu Arbeiten wo man kann ist auch nicht verkehrt!
__________________

Ge?ndert von Stifler (03.04.2011 um 14:59 Uhr)
Stifler ist offline   Mit Zitat antworten Nach oben